Chip Nelson

EVP Senior Lender - Chief Credit Officer at Affinity Bank

Chip Nelson has had a diverse work experience, starting in 1990 as the owner of a sports memorabilia store called Centerfield. From 1998 to 1999, they worked as a commercial lending associate at SunTrust Bank. In 1999, they joined Community Trust Bank as a VP and senior credit officer. In 2003, they became the EVP and chief credit officer at Affinity Bank, where they led the lending team, maintained lending policies, and supervised credit standards. Chip stayed with Affinity Bank until at least 2011, during which they also took on the role of chairman of the board at Mountain Area Christian Academy from 2012 to 2015.

Chip Nelson attended Kennesaw State University from 1993 to 1996, where they pursued studies in Business Administration and Management, General. Following that, from 1996 to 1998, they enrolled at the Georgia Institute of Technology and obtained a Bachelor of Science in Management, specializing in Finance.
